N137 OPN is a 1996 Rover 114 in Red with a 1,396cc petrol engine. This vehicle has been through 14 MOT tests with a personal pass rate of 64.3%.
Across all 1996 Rover 114 models, the average MOT pass rate is 63.3% with a typical mileage of 51,120 miles. This particular vehicle has performed better than the average for its year.
The most common reason a Rover 114 fails its MOT is seat belt anchorage prescribed area is excessively corroded, accounting for 11,635 recorded failures. If you're considering buying N137 OPN, it's worth having these areas checked by a mechanic before committing.
The Rover 114 typically stays on UK roads for around 31 years. At 30 years old, this Rover 114 is approaching the upper end of the typical lifespan for this model.
